A big six club has made a late swoop to sign Ivan Toney from Brentford.
The England striker has been linked with a move away from Brentford all summer, and has been left out of Thomas Frank's squad for the first two games of the Premier League season.
This was following reports that Toney was on the verge of a move to Saudi Arabia, and earlier today it was reported he had agreed a switch to Al-Ahli.
However, Chelsea have now swooped in with a late bid for the striker, according to Sky Sports.
Sky Sports News' chief reported Kaveh Solhekol says the London side have a "pretty good chance" of being successful in their bid for Toney, who will move for a "reasonable" transfer fee and fit into Chelsea's wage structure.
The 28-year-old has one year left on his Brentford contract and has been linked with a move away all summer.
Throughout the transfer window, Chelsea have reportedly been looking at a move for Napoli striker Victor Osimhen, but it seems they have turned their attention to Toney now.
If successful in their pursuit of him, it would be the latest big name signing for the Stamford Bridge outfit, who have already signed the likes of Kiernan Dewsbury-Hall, Pedro Neto and Joao Felix this summer.
